CACHE Level 3 Diploma for the Early Years Workforce (Early Years Educator). This course allows you to work with your employer 4 days a week and come to college on day release (college attendance is currently set at 95%). During your time at college you will cover written knowledge and be set assignments and homework tasks. Your tutor will also visit you every other month in your workplace setting and assess your occupational competence. Evidence methods include: - Direct observations - Professional discussions - Expert witness statements - Reflective accounts - Written tasks - Assignment work - Case studies - Child observations - Planning your own work products with children - Children-s activity planning The course has a pass or refer grading system.
